Hand Thought is an exhibition of wooden tableware and accompanying 2D works developed by Justin Marshall. The works explore both the artistic opportunities that CNC (computer numerically controlled) technologies can hold for the maker, and questions whe re the line between hand and machine-made lies — if it exists at all?

Justin sees tools not as neutral means to an end, but as constructive elements entangled in the creative process. This understanding of technology in making provides a foundation for his exploration and celebration of tools in a characteristically crafty way.
